Riassunto
Purpose of the present work is to examine the right of access to documents in the European Union with particular focus on the principle of transparency. The analysis features, first of all, the evolution and legal framework of the right, moving from its very origins in the Nordic countries, to Regulation No 1049/2001 of the European Parliament and Council and the Council of Europe Convention on Access to Official Documents, through the founding treaties of the Union. Moreover, this work focuses on how the right of access and the exceptions provisioned by the EU law affect the transparency and accountability of the European Union’s administration. In the second part of the work are presented and examined six cases concerning the right of access to documents brought before the European Court of Justice. The extensive legal background presented in the first part of the thesis enables to fully understand the analysis of the six cases, which completes the work providing evidence of how the right of access to documents has been applied in practicality. The analysis provided in this work, in its entirety, shows that the right of access to documents is central when it comes to guaranteeing the most democratic structure and functioning of the public administration, and that the effort made by the institutions and the interest shown by the European citizens prove the importance of this right in their every-day dynamics.
